LinkedIn's Member & Customer Success (MCS) team is seeking a Sr.
Planning & Resource Optimization Analyst who will enhance the
member and customer experience by providing actionable staffing
insights. ---Key responsibilities in this role include analyzing
contact center data and trends to create detailed workload models,
recommending solutions to improve overall operational efficiency,
as well as maintaining a focus on meeting service level agreements
and maintaining agent work/life balance.
Responsibilities:
Create forecasts of contact volume (email, phone, chat, etc.),
handling time, shrinkage and other workforce related metrics based
on trends and understood business drivers
Determine headcount recommendations and hiring needs for customer
support teams
Develop and evaluate agent schedules to meet operational goals
Intra-day monitoring to optimize resources real time and achieve
goal of providing consistent and timely service to members
Deliver accurate and well-timed reports/dashboards to all levels of
leadership providing actionable insights
Maintain and organize detailed records of contact center data &
trends including service level, response time, etc.
Create and maintain capacity planning models for short-term and
long-term forecasts
Support ad hoc requests & analyses to explore proposed business
changes
Gain proficiency with LinkedIn's WFM enterprise software and drive
system enhancements to accommodate business needs with technology
teams and software vendors as needed
Manage escalation process to ensure leadership and relevant
stakeholders are well informed
Create and maintain documentation to support day to day
procedures
Present & articulate analyses to all levels of leadership and
stakeholder audiences
Prepare and lead instructional and educational presentations
